Making a brief URL support is an interesting undertaking that requires many aspects of software enhancement, such as Net advancement, databases administration, and API design and style. This is a detailed overview of the topic, with a concentrate on the crucial factors, difficulties, and greatest techniques linked to building a URL shortener.

one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way online wherein a lengthy URL is often transformed into a shorter, additional workable sort. This shortened URL redirects to the first lengthy URL when visited.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are well-identified exam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social networking plat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ts produced it hard to share very long URLs.

Beyond social media marketing, URL shorteners are helpful in advertising and marketing strategies, e-mail, and printed media where by extensive URLs may be cumbersome.

two. Main Components of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ener generally consists of the following parts:

Internet Interface: Here is the entrance-stop portion wherever consumers can enter their extensive URLs and receive shortened versions. It may be an easy variety on a web page.
Database: A databases is critical to store the mapping involving the first very long URL and also the sh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L options like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This is actually the backend logic that can take the small URL and redirects the consumer to your corresponding very long URL. This logic will likely be executed in the world wide web server or an software layer.
API: Several URL shorteners provide an API in order that third-bash pur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first long URLs.
three.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a protracted URL into a short a single. Several procedures can be utilized, which include:

Hashing: The extensive URL can be hashed into a fixed-sizing string, which serves because the limited URL. However, hash collisions (distinct URLs causing a similar hash) have to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One prevalent method is to implement Base62 encoding (which utilizes s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, in addition to a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ds on the entry in the databases. This technique makes certain that the shorter URL is as brief as is possible.
Random String Technology: One more tactic would be to produce a random string of a set duration (e.g., 6 figures) and Verify if it’s presently in use during the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ned to your prolonged URL.
4. Database Administration
The database schema for the URL shortener is often clear-cut, with two primary fields:

ID: A unique identifier for each URL entry.
Long UR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Small URL/Slug: The quick Variation from the URL, typically saved as a novel string.
Together with these, you may want to keep metadata including the creation date, expiration date, and the quantity of periods the quick URL continues to be accessed.

5. Handling Redirection
Redirection is actually a crucial A part of the URL shortener's operation. When a user clicks on a brief URL, the services must speedily retrieve the initial URL within the databases and redirect the user employing an HTTP 301 (long lasting redirect) or 302 (non permanent redirect) standing code.

Efficiency is key in this article, as the method ought to be just about instantaneous. Strategies like databases ind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) may be utilized to speed up the retrieval system.

six. Protection Factors
Safety is an important problem in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ener could be abused to unfold destructive hyperl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-bash security providers to check UR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this hazard.
Spam Prevention: Level limiting and CAPTCHA can avoid abuse by spammers seeking to deliver thousands of brief UR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age numerous UR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out various servers to take care of significant masses.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Independent considerations like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inct providers to impro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ners normally offer anal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the traffic is coming from, and other practical metrics. This involves logging Every single red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.

9. Summary
Creating a URL shortener requires a blend of frontend and backend enhancement, database administration, and a focus to security and scalability. Though it could seem like an easy services, developing a robust, economical, and safe URL shortener offers numerous challenges and involves cautious setting up and execution. No matter if you’re developing it for personal use, inside company equipment, or as a community company, knowing the fundamental principles and finest practices is essential for achievements.
